As a part time Chef at the Treble Bob – Harvester, you will master our menu, with your food being the reason guests keep coming through our doors! You’ll enjoy working in a team, serving up food to be proud of. Does this sound like the chef job for you?
Join us at Harvester, the nation\’s family favourite. Famous for our fresh rotisserie chicken, sizzling grills and unlimited salad bar, we pride ourselves on offering feel good dining for the nation. Fancy a fresh start? We want to hear from you.
WHAT’S IN IT FOR ME?
- Flexible shifts to fit around you.
- A massive 33% discount across all our brands. Whether it\’s date night at Miller & Carter or a family roast at Toby Carvery, we’ve got you covered.
- 20% discount off all of our brands for friends and family.
- Wagestream – a financial toolkit that helps you manage your finances and allows you to access your earned pay when you need it.
- Opportunities to grow with paid for qualifications.
- Opportunity for progression; on average 200 Chefs are promoted to Head Chef every year.
- Discounts on gym memberships.
- Team Socials – work hard, play hard!
On top of this, as part of Mitchells & Butlers you will receive a pension; 28 days paid holiday; high-street shopping discounts; and we even give you free shares! There\’s also a free employee helpline to support you with whatever life throws at you.
WHAT WILL I BE DOING? AS A CHEF YOU’LL…
- Prepare everything that is needed before service.
- Cook food to be proud of and know the menu inside out.
- Maintain the highest standards of cleanliness and safety.

How to prepare for a job interview at Harvester
✨Know the Menu Inside Out
Familiarise yourself with the Treble Bob - Harvester menu before the interview. Being able to discuss your favourite dishes and how you would prepare them shows your passion for the role and helps you stand out.
✨Showcase Your Team Spirit
As a chef, teamwork is crucial. Be prepared to share examples of how you've successfully worked in a team environment in the past. Highlighting your ability to collaborate will resonate well with the interviewers.
✨Emphasise Cleanliness and Safety Standards
Discuss your understanding of kitchen hygiene and safety protocols. Mention any relevant experience you have in maintaining cleanliness in a kitchen setting, as this is vital for any chef role.
✨Express Your Desire for Growth
Mention your interest in progression and learning opportunities. The company values growth, so expressing your eagerness to develop your skills and potentially move up to a Head Chef position can make a positive impression.
